How to fill out international trust

How to fill out an international trust:
01
Gather necessary documents: Start by collecting all the required legal and financial documents for the trust, such as identification papers, financial statements, and any relevant agreements or contracts.
02
Choose a trustee: Select a trustee who will be responsible for managing the trust and making decisions in accordance with its terms. This can be an individual or a professional trustee, depending on your preferences and needs.
03
Determine the trust's purposes and beneficiaries: Clearly define the objectives and goals of the trust, as well as the individuals or entities who will benefit from its assets and income.
04
Draft the trust agreement: Consult with a qualified attorney to draft a comprehensive trust agreement that outlines the terms and conditions of the trust. This agreement should cover key areas such as the trustee's powers, how distributions will be made, and any specific instructions or restrictions.
05
Fund the trust: Transfer assets into the trust, which can include properties, bank accounts, investments, or any other assets designated to be managed and distributed by the trust.
06
Comply with legal requirements: Ensure that the trust is properly registered and complies with any relevant laws, regulations, and tax obligations in the jurisdiction where it is established.
07
Maintain and manage the trust: Regularly review and update the trust as necessary, keeping track of any changes in the beneficiaries or objectives of the trust. Monitor the trust's investments and ensure that the trustee is fulfilling their obligations.
08
Review and update regularly: It's important to review the trust periodically to ensure its continued relevance and effectiveness given any changes in personal circumstances, tax laws, or financial goals.
Who needs an international trust?
01
High-net-worth individuals: International trusts can be beneficial for individuals with substantial assets and complex financial situations. Trusts offer various advantages for tax planning, asset protection, and estate planning purposes.
02
Expatriates and global nomads: Individuals who frequently move between countries or have substantial international interests can benefit from an international trust. It can help with managing assets and inheritance across multiple jurisdictions.
03
Business owners and investors: International trusts can offer effective structures for holding and protecting business assets, investments, and intellectual property.
04
Those seeking privacy and confidentiality: An international trust can provide enhanced privacy and confidentiality by separating personal assets from public record and reducing the risk of unwanted attention or scrutiny.
05
Succession planning: International trusts are often used as part of estate planning strategies to ensure a smooth wealth transfer to future generations, minimize tax liabilities, and preserve family wealth.
Overall, international trusts can be a useful tool for various individuals and entities, offering advantages in terms of asset protection, tax planning, privacy, and efficient wealth management across different jurisdictions. However, it is essential to consult with legal and financial professionals who specialize in international trusts to ensure compliance with applicable laws and to tailor the trust structure to individual needs and goals.

What is international trust?
An international trust is a legal arrangement where assets are held by a trustee for the benefit of beneficiaries located in different countries.
Who is required to file international trust?
Individuals or entities who set up international trusts or act as trustees may be required to file international trust forms depending on their country's tax laws.
How to fill out international trust?
International trust forms must be filled out accurately and completely, including details about the trust's settlor, trustees, beneficiaries, assets, and income.
What is the purpose of international trust?
The purpose of an international trust is typically to protect and manage assets, provide for beneficiaries, minimize taxes, and maintain privacy.
What information must be reported on international trust?
Information such as the trust's income, assets, distributions, beneficiaries, and any changes to the trust must be reported on international trust forms.
